Transaction dc516c81f5a0a27ca107d73a8fe69bf38aea7f581d4095bd8fa9ced438631bd3
1 Input
1 Output
-
dc516c81f5a0a27ca107d73a8fe69bf38aea7f581d4095bd8fa9ced438631bd3:0
- value
- 142637
- script pubkey
- OP_0 OP_PUSHBYTES_20 69bdef5e43b0c0c90c4104724bc6b93c86608fb7
- address
- bc1qdx777hjrkrqvjrzpq3eyh34e8jrxprah2cca6t